What is the best way to get to San Fernando from Buenos Aires?
The best way to get to San Fernando from Buenos Aires is by taking a train from Retiro Station to San Fernando Station, which takes about 30 minutes.
Are there any cultural events or festivals in San Fernando?
Yes, San Fernando hosts various cultural events and festivals throughout the year, showcasing local music, art, and traditions.
What are some popular attractions in San Fernando?
Popular attractions in San Fernando include the Parque de la Costa amusement park, the historic San Fernando Cathedral, and the beautiful waterfront area.
Is it safe to walk around San Fernando at night?
While San Fernando is generally safe, it's advisable to stay in well-lit areas and avoid walking alone late at night.
What are the top recommended foods to try in San Fernando?
When in San Fernando, be sure to try the local empanadas, asado, and dulce de leche desserts, which are all Argentine favorites.

When to visit

The best time to visit San Fernando is during the spring (September to November) and fall (March to May) when the weather is mild and pleasant. During these seasons, temperatures range from 15°C to 25°C (59°F to 77°F), making it ideal for outdoor activities and sightseeing. Summer can be quite hot, with temperatures often exceeding 30°C (86°F), while winter can be chilly, especially in June and July. Rainfall is more common in the summer months, so travelers should be prepared for occasional showers. Overall, spring and fall offer the most comfortable conditions for exploring the city.

Getting around

Getting around San Fernando is relatively easy, with various transportation options available. The city is well-connected by public buses that can take you to different neighborhoods and attractions. Taxis and ride-sharing services are also widely available, providing a convenient way to navigate the area. For those who prefer a more leisurely pace, renting a bicycle is a great option, as the city has several bike-friendly paths. Additionally, walking is a pleasant way to explore the charming streets and parks at your own pace.

Traveller tips

When visiting San Fernando, it's advisable to learn a few basic Spanish phrases, as not everyone speaks English. Be sure to try the local cuisine, especially the empanadas and asado, which are must-try dishes. Keep an eye on your belongings, especially in crowded areas, to avoid pickpocketing. It's also a good idea to check the local weather forecast before your trip to pack accordingly. Lastly, take the time to explore the nearby natural reserves for a taste of Argentina's stunning landscapes.
